Pre-School I & II
Children in the preschool programs are guided through the process of following a simple routine, making friends, communicating their needs and ideas, developing self control over action and emotion and exploring a variety of social/emotional language and cognitive activities in a warm, safe and nurturing environment. The teachers in this class are assisted by parents on a rotating basis approximately once every 4-5 weeks. Mom or Dad work in the classroom as the assistant to the teacher. The parent helper is an important element of the program by participating in the supervision of the children, the activities that are offered and bring a healthy snack to share with the class on their child’s “Special Day”. The programs are a unique and wonderful beginning to early childhood education for both parent and child.

Pre-Kindergarten
The PreK class is designed for the four or five year old that will be entering Kindergarten the following year. The program continues the important foundation of social and emotional development started in our preschool program. The increase in communication skills, as well as the growing sense of independence, shifts the focus of the program to include more work on problem solving and social skills. To this end, the teachers encourage and support creative thinking, curiosity and independent decision making through a project approach to curriculum. The students in this class will be offered a wide range of experiences and opportunities for learning. The curriculum considers the needs and interest of the group and addresses each of the important areas of learning: math, science, social studies, language and literacy. Each day includes an opportunity for children to eat lunch at school with their peers. Teachers invite parents to join the classroom on a volunteer basis.

Summer Program
STEAM into Summer! Building off of Loft School’s almost 60-year history as the premier cooperative preschool in the tri-town area, we are pleased offer an enriching summer program for children ages 2.9-5. Enrollment is limited to ensure a low student-teacher ratio and the summer program emphasizes learning through play.
